News summary

Ronald Holmes III resigned Friday as national finance director for Maine Senate candidate Graham Platner, saying his professional standards no longer aligned with the campaign. He is the third major staff exit after campaign manager Kevin Brown and political director Genevieve McDonald left amid turmoil. The departures followed resurfaced social-media and Reddit posts of offensive comments and the revelation Platner had a Totenkopf-style tattoo he says he is now covering; Platner has denied knowing the tattoo’s meaning and defended his background. The campaign says Holmes focused on courting big-dollar donors while nearly 90% of its receipts have come from small-dollar online contributions and that it raised more than $3.2 million in the first six weeks. Platner, a 41-year-old military veteran and oyster farmer endorsed by Sen. Bernie Sanders, faces intensified scrutiny over his viability ahead of a competitive Democratic primary against Sen. Susan Collins in 2026.
